Output dca32ce06183ec121de89464918ed8365d42fbf35c71da93a461041a5957cf7e:0

value
31389499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e7eebbcc4d3af9d292c663cf32c1794909c3f0f OP_EQUAL
address
MDbcAwQcxtZPCFHHEi9A8z2gPcd8SSow8R
transaction
dca32ce06183ec121de89464918ed8365d42fbf35c71da93a461041a5957cf7e
spent
true